John Passaniti <john.passaniti@gmail.com> writes:
> Elegant... and stupidly expensive in both RAM and processor cycles...
> That's 20 bytes of stack wasted to print a number.

Well, "wasted" implies that you don't get it back when the function
returns, which you do.  More relevant is whether some other path in the
application uses even more stack depth, in which case you have to 
reserve the stack space anyway.

Keep in mind also that the most likely reason to encounter this code is
it's inside code you're porting from some other project or product.
That means if you rewrite it, in addition to the
programming/testing/process effort of "fixing" something that is already
tested and working, you now have an unnecessary fork point in your code
base, something that requires some level of justification beyond
"stupidly expensive".  (Does anyone use 128-byte 8051's any more
anyway?)

Remember too that the iterative version will probably use a pointer
variable (2 bytes) and an in-memory buffer (5 bytes), so the recursive
version maybe only uses 12-13 more bytes, not 20.  And of course the
iterative version can be done pretty badly too: look at
http://www.cpm.z80.de/small_c.html, extract the
http://www.cpm.z80.de/small_c/smc88dos.zip (small C for 8088) zip file,
look at itoa.c and the layers of crap it calls, and weep.  Its stack
consumption looks like more than 20 bytes when you count everything.

As for CPU cycles, the i/o and the division by 10 may dominate the stack
operations either way.

> Yes, creating a virtual machine is one way to bring C (and other
> languages) to the GA144.  The obvious advantage being that one can
> design and optimize the virtual machine for the language, and one can
> run much larger programs than one could on any individual processor.

Right, that's the idea, to run big programs and existing code.  On the
GA node itself, I don't see much point to trying to write in C, since
with only 64 words of program memory, writing in assembler (i.e. Array
Forth) is not much of a roadblock, and there's no useful existing C code
to port anyway.  From what I can tell you really do have to program
those things at quite a low level, carefully managing the partitioning
and interaction between nodes.  You can't just plop nodes down like
bricks based on the amount of resources you need.  So the request for a
C compiler targeted to a VM is like suggesting a softcore processor that
runs C for an FPGA.

> Targeting a virtual machine is the kind of thing I would do for larger
> code that didn't need to run at insanely fast speeds, such as user
> interfaces, Ethernet network stacks, and stuff like that.  

Yes, that is the idea.

> Targeting the processors themselves would be more for signal
> processing, implementing hardware, etc.

If you want a HLL for that, C just seems like a terrible choice.
Better to concoct some DSL that carefully tracks the stack content,
has interprocedural optimization, knows about inter-node communication,
etc.
